Transaction 67936443fda4fafda24437bb3ec9ce7b4f24d0a74c603fca7f38565f1d62157a
1 Input
1 Output
-
67936443fda4fafda24437bb3ec9ce7b4f24d0a74c603fca7f38565f1d62157a:0
- value
- 58560000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4754b2dc568b49b3af8f44a201ee323d5ca9590 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LNNmNkDsYs6MbDx94k2kCHEdhQiZWLuhC